Our CELPIP course is divided into four key modules to build essential skills in each test area:
Listening: Practice identifying key details and main ideas, understanding implied meanings, and responding to everyday situations.
Reading: Develop strategies for identifying specific information, analyzing tone and structure, and enhancing comprehension of diverse texts.
Writing: Learn to craft organized and clear written responses with a focus on grammar, vocabulary, and relevant examples.
Speaking: Gain confidence and fluency through real-life scenario practice, accent reduction techniques, and constructive feedback.
